Can you cook bacon in a convection toaster oven?

You may need to cut the bacon to fit, depending on the size of the pan. Set the toaster o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it (do not pre-heat) and bake to your preferred degree of crispiness. For most ovens, it should take about 8-15 minutes.

Similarly, can I cook bacon in the toaster oven?

While many people cook bacon on the stovetop or in the microwave, bacon can come out crispy in a toaster oven. There is often less cleanup and the bacon will just as delicious. First, you have to place bacon on a baking sheet. Bake it for 10 to 15 minutes until it reaches your desired level of crispiness.

Considering this, can you cook meat in a convection toaster oven? The forced air of a convection oven works well for roasting meats and vegetables since the circulated air helps to crisp and brown up foods better than a conventional oven.

In this manner, should I use convection for bacon?

Typical thick-sliced bacon baking on an aluminum foil-lined baking sheet will take 15 to 25 minutes at 400 degrees Fahrenheit. … Tip: Using the convection setting on your oven will bake the bacon more quickly and evenly by circulating the hot air around the oven making it even more perfectly crispy.

What does convection mean on a toaster oven?

Convection toaster ovens work by means of a fan that circulates hot air around the oven. By making the air circulate all around the oven, your food gets heated evenly and without cold spots.

What temperature do you cook bacon in a toaster oven?

Set the temperature to 400°F, and lay the bacon slices (we like thick cut here) flat on a baking sheet or your toaster oven pan. Bake, for about 12-15 minutes, or until the bacon is done to your liking.
